Abstract
The stability of the polarization-resolved (PR) light output of a commercial vertical-cavity surface-emitting laser (VCSEL) has been studied with and without the presence of external optical injection in a master-slave configuration. Pulsations in the PR light output are observed in the solitary laser at certain bias current. It has been observed here for the first time that optical injection can stabilize the polarization of a VCSEL operating in a pulsation regime.
